Daring Danger Trailer (1932)
A wounded cowboy catches rustlers who use a trick branding iron.

Tim McCoy as Tim Madigan
Alberta Vaughn as Gerry Norris
Wallace MacDonald as Jughandle (as Wallace McDonald)
Richard Alexander as Bull Bagley
Murdock MacQuarrie as Pa Norris (as Murdock McGuarrie)
Vernon Dent as Bartender Pee Wee
Edward LeSaint as First Ranch Owner (as Ed LeSaint)
Robert Ellis as Hugo DuSang
Michael Trevellian Adaptation
Otto Meyer Editor
William Colt MacDonald Story
D. Ross Lederman Director
Benjamin H. Kline Director of Photography
United Kingdom 22 June 1932
United States 27 July 1932
